Do tortoise like to be stroked?

Most tortoises seem to enjoy being touched. A sign that the animal wants to be petted is when they extend their necks out while being touched or massaged. Should I soak my tortoise everyday?

All tortoises should be bathed daily or every other day in the period of winding down in preparation for hibernation. Only use fresh water and do not add detergents of any kind, as this may damage the shell, and NEVER polish or shine a tortoise’s shell with oil or shell conditioners as this may damage the shell.

Do tortoises like their shells scratched?

In most cases, tortoises enjoy having their shell scratched or petted. Keep in mind that this area is very sensitive and should be handled with care. Learn more about tortoise shells and why they’re so important to them.
